Abstract

       The work is devoted to Mössbauer studies of new building materials derived from wastes from coal-fired power plants. Measurements of Mössbauer spectrometers were carried out on the MC1104EM unit in the regime of constant acceleration with a source of 57Co (Cr). The elemental composition of each sample was determined by means of X-ray fluorescence analysis (XRF) on the RLP-21 installation. According to the results of studies of volume-surface concentric-zonal color effects in zoloceramic materials, the phase composition of iron compounds and their ratios is established by the Mössbauer method, and their elemental composition with 32 components is determined with high accuracy by means of XRF. The technology of obtaining gold-ceramic materials with volumetric-surface color effects is described.
